The Sales Manager is responsible for driving sales growth, managing key accounts, and overseeing distribution within across the geographic territory of Madagascar for vehicle parts and quincaillerie goods and associated products.

 

Key Responsibilities:

1. Sales Growth and Target Achievement:

o Develop and execute sales strategies to achieve territory sales targets and revenue goals.

o Monitor performance against sales targets and adjust strategies as needed to drive results.

o Regularly report on sales activities, performance, and progress to senior management.

2. Market Expansion and Distribution Management:

o Identify and evaluate potential new customers, distribution channels, and retail partners.

o Expand product distribution within the assigned territory by working with distributors, wholesalers, and retailers.

o Ensure consistent product availability across all key retail outlets and channels.

3. Relationship Building:

o Build and maintain strong relationships with key clients, including distributors, retailers, and wholesalers.

o Collaborate with clients to drive brand loyalty and repeat business.

o Provide exceptional customer service by resolving issues and addressing customer needs.

4. Product Visibility and Merchandising:

o Implement merchandising and in-store promotional strategies to enhance product visibility.

o Work with retail partners to ensure that products are well-displayed and meet brand standards.

o Monitor and evaluate product placement, pricing, and shelf space within stores.

5. Market Intelligence and Competitor Analysis:

o Gather and analyze market data, including consumer trends, competitor activities, and industry developments.

o Share insights with the management team to adjust strategies and stay ahead of competition.

o Conduct regular market visits to assess consumer behavior and competitor activity.

6. Promotional Activities:

o Plan, execute, and manage in-store promotions, sampling, and trade offers.

o Coordinate with the marketing team to ensure the alignment of promotional activities with the overall brand strategy.

o Track the effectiveness of promotions and make recommendations for improvement.

7. Training and Team Management:

o Train and mentor sales representatives and distributors on product knowledge, sales techniques, and company policies.

o Lead by example in terms of sales best practices, customer relationship management, and team collaboration.

8. Reporting and Documentation:

o Maintain accurate records of sales activities, customer interactions, and stock levels.

o Prepare and submit regular sales reports, including sales forecasts, market trends, and competitor activities.

o Ensure compliance with company policies and procedures.

 

Qualifications & Skills:

· Education: Bachelor's degree in Business, Marketing, Sales, or a related field.

· Experience:

o Minimum of 3-5 years of experience in sales or business development in the vehicle parts and quincaillerie sales industry.

o Proven track record of meeting or exceeding sales targets.

o Experience in managing a territory or region with a strong understanding of distribution channels and retail networks.

 

Working Conditions:

· Full-time position, with regular travel within Madagascar.

· Occasional evening and weekend work for events, trade shows, or client meetings.

· Field-based role with the possibility of office work for administrative tasks.

 

This role is critical to driving the growth and market penetration of assigned products across Madagascar. The Sales Manager will play an instrumental role in enhancing the brand’s visibility and sales performance, fostering long-term customer relationships, and contributing to the overall success of the business.
